Day 1 Arrive - Christchurch - Hanmer Springs

On arrival your driver/tour guide will welcome you. Alternatively uplift your rental car from our Airport representative. Departing the Airport transfer to Braemar Lodge. This luxury retreat is nestled in the North Canterbury mountains, just 5 kilometres from the charming alpine and thermal resort of Hanmer Springs. The Lodge is the perfect place to relax after a long flight - the views over the huge Hanmer River Basin to the snow capped mountains beyond are truly awesome. For the active there are a host of different walking tracks to choose.

Overnight Bremear Lodge
Meals include breakfast and dinner

Day 2 Hanmer Springs

Today is free for activities. Recommended are - travelling to the coastal village of Kaikoura for a whalewatch excursion. Here the opportunity exists to observe the Sperm Whale, Wright Whales and Orcas In addition to whales seals, dolphins and a host of other sea birds may be seen. Alternatively take advantage of the activities offered around the Hanmer region these include jet boating, horse trekking, rafting trout fishing, trail walking to name just a few.

Day 3 Hanmer Springs - Greymouth

Departing Hanmer the route travels West over the Southern Alps, the South Island's main divide. Traverse Porters and Arthurs Pass both at an elevation of over a 1000 meters. Decend rapidly towards the Tasman Sea along a highway surround by towering snow capped mountains with lower slopes covered with luxuriant native forest. Situated at short distance from Greymouth is Lake Brunner, a still deep lake surrounded by beautiful forested mountains.

Day 4 Greymouth - Franz Josef

Today travel down the West Coast of the South Island. Drive through stands of native forest and over swift flowing rivers to arrive at Franz Josef Glacier. Time should be allowed during the journey for numerous photo stops and small detours to view the many scenic lakes and walks. A scenic helicopter flight over the Glacier with on snow landing is one of the popular activities. For the more active the opportunity exists to take a guided Glacier walk.

Day 5 Franz Josef - Queenstown

Leaving Franz Josef the route travels south over Mount Hercules to Franz Josef 's sister town of Fox Glacier, before continuing on to Haast. Farewelling the coast the highway follows the Landsborough River before traversing Hasst Pass. The route passes through some of New Zealand's finest scenery, with spectacular waterfalls, towering mountains and dense rain forests. Crossing the Pass the highway skirts Lakes Wanaka and Hawea before continuing past the hydro lake, Lake Dunstan. Travel through the rugged Kawarau Gorge to the alpine resort of Queenstown.

Day 7 Milford Sound Excursion

Depart Queenstown early this morning and round Lake Wakatipu before crossing northern Southland to reach Te Anau. Drive through the Eglinton Valley with its hanging glacier valleys, pristine temperate rainforest and towering peaks. Exiting the Homer Tunnel arrive at Milford Sound. Cruise on the Sound and inspect up close the cascading waterfalls, sea life and towering rock faces which rise over 5000 ft. The flight back to Queenstown provides views of hanging valleys, alpine lakes and cloud-piercing summits hidden from the road. The return flight is truly memorable. Day 8 Queenstown - Dunedin

Leaving Queenstown retrace the route along the Kawarau Gorge to Cromwell before heading east towards Dunedin. Travel through the arid bolder strewn Central Otago, amazingly this hostile land is one of New Zealand's premier fruit growing regions. Traverse Saddle Hill to arrive in Dunedin. The City takes its unusual name from the Gaelic name for Edinburgh Scotland. This afternoon sightseeing may include an excursion on the Otago Peninsula to visit the Royal Albatross Colony, Blue and Yellow Eyed Penguin colonies and the many fur-seals that bask on the Peninsula's shores. Alternatively for a more relaxing time explore the City's many fine examples of New Zealand's Victorian architecture.

Day 10 Dunedin - Mt. Cook

Drive north from Dunedin over Kilmog Hill and past beautiful Blue Skin Bay to the town of Oamaru, famous for its white sandstone buildings. Travelling inland follow the Waitaki River to the Waitaki and MacKenzie Basins. The highway passes by many vast hydro lakes and power stations - this region produces a large percentage of New Zealand's electricity. Arrive Mount Cook village, at the base New Zealand's highest mountain (Mt. Cook 3754 metres). Recommended is a scenic flight with on snow landing. Many short alpine walks can be under taken around Mount Cook village. All have breathtaking views in every direction.

Day 11 Mt. Cook - Christchurch

Departing Mount Cook pass Lakes Pukaki and Tekapo before crossing Burkes Pass and descending towards the Canterbury Plains. Cross the Plains, a patch work of perfectly ploughed and planted fields, to arrive Christchurch.
